Los Angeles is now top apparel producing place in US

Los Angeles in California state has become the number one place for garment and textile manufacturing in the United States.

Clothing and textile sector earnings of Los Angeles have grown from US$ 22.8 billion in 1997 to US$ 40.3 billion in 2010. This is in spite of a reduction in workforce by nearly half during the same period, according to Ilse Metchek, President of the California Fashion Association.

The apparel and textile related manufacturing sector in the Southern Californian region, including Orange County and San Diego, employed 207.318 workers in 1997. However, this number reduced to 128,148 people in 2010, said Metchek while speaking at the “2012 West Coast Manufacturing Conference”.

During the intertwining years, entrepreneurs have retained segments of manufacturing that they are doing best and have outsourced the remaining.

The Los Angeles garment and textile manufacturers are in the process of increasing their sales through e-commerce, speakers said at the conference.
